副Java,作为Java编程语言的一个新兴分支,近年来在编程领域崭露头角。它不仅继承了Java的强大功能和稳定性能,还在某些方面进行了创新和优化,以满足现代软件开发的需求。本文将深入探讨副Java的崛...
副Java,作为Java编程语言的一个新兴分支,近年来在编程领域崭露头角。它不仅继承了Java的强大功能和稳定性能,还在某些方面进行了创新和优化,以满足现代软件开发的需求。本文将深入探讨副Java的崛起之路,分析其特点和优势,以及如何成为一名副Java编程新星。
副Java的诞生,源于Java编程语言在长期发展过程中积累的经验和教训。随着互联网和移动设备的普及,软件开发的需求日益多样化,Java作为一门成熟的编程语言,逐渐暴露出一些局限性。为了弥补这些不足,副Java应运而生。
副Java的发展历程可以分为以下几个阶段:
副Java对Java虚拟机(JVM)进行了优化,提高了内存管理的效率。通过改进垃圾回收算法和内存分配策略,副Java在保证程序稳定性的同时,降低了内存消耗。
副Java提供了丰富的并发编程工具和库,如ReactiveX、CompletableFuture等,简化了多线程编程,提高了并发性能。
副Java继承了Java的跨平台特性,支持一次编写,到处运行。这使得副Java应用程序能够在各种操作系统和硬件平台上高效运行。
副Java拥有庞大的社区支持和丰富的第三方库,如Spring、Hibernate等,为开发者提供了便捷的开发工具和丰富的功能。
首先,要掌握副Java的基本语法、数据结构、面向对象编程等基础知识。
学习副Java的常用框架和工具,如Spring、MyBatis等,提高开发效率。
深入研究副Java的内存管理、并发编程、跨平台特性等特性,提升编程水平。
加入副Java社区,与其他开发者交流学习,共同进步。
通过参与副Java项目,积累实战经验,提升解决问题的能力。
副Java作为编程新星,凭借其高效、稳定、易用的特性,在软件开发领域崭露头角。通过不断学习和实践,相信越来越多的开发者将加入副Java的行列,成为编程新星。